Chundi is depicted with many arms. This symbolizes her ability to use skillful means to help beings in countless ways. The statue is seated on a lotus. The crown and jewelry symbolize her enlightened status, flower represents purity and spiritual awakening. The third eye on her forehead symbolizes her all-seeing wisdom. She is in Anjali Mudra.

In many Buddhist traditions, Chundi Devi represents the peak of heavenly feminine power and wisdom. She represents the universe's protecting and caring character and is frequently shown with a slew of arms, each bearing a spiritual emblem. Chundi Devi's presence as a deity is said to dissolve impediments, increase wisdom, and inspire favors, making her a popular image in rituals seeking spiritual power and enlightenment.
